150. Deputy Róisín Shortall asked the Minister for Public Expenditure and Reform the gross saving he intends to achieve from the public sector payroll in each of the years 2013 to 2015 with a breakdown by saving type, that is reduction in head count, overtime, core pay, increments, allowances and so on; and if he will provide an analysis of the net saving that will be achieved when income tax, USC, PRSI, pension levies and so on are factored in and when account is also taken of the effect on VAT and other Exchequer revenue streams. [10661/13]
